Reverse

Mid-length female figure left, playing pipes.

Script: Latin

Lettering:
MUSICA 1997
R L 500

Engraver: Ettore Lorenzo Frapiccini

Edge

Segmented reeding

Comment

Music. Simple, melodious, popular in one of its most classic expressions, the tibia player that the Greek Karneia has handed down to us in a vase painted in southern Italy around 400 BC.
